The Twelve Virtues of a Good Teacher

"The Twelve Virtues of a Good Teacher by Brother Agathon, fifth Superior General of the Brothers of the Christian Schools from 1777 - 1795 is, in my view, after the monumental text we know as The Conduct of Schools, the most significant work in education in the Lasallian heritage."

Br. Gerard Rummery, FSC.
